Ug wrote:
I got turned down for a Tr100 vs Tr100 new team game because my FF was too low...

On average a FF of 9 (instead of my 4) would have added only 10,000 to the winnings.


I have to agree with Mezir here. Playing against teams with a high FF your first few games is simply the smarter way to go.

It means more cash, even if you lose, which in turn makes surviving the first few games much more likely.

The difference between the extreme of 20 FF combined and 10 FF combined is 20K per game at TR 100-125, or specifically an average of 70K versus 50K.
